Prams are among the most commonly used baby products. They are durable, and maintenance is simple. They also have the potential for circularity, if policy interventions ensure that second-hand prams are renovated and redistributed to new parents.

baby-jogger-summit-x3-all-terrain-jogging-pushchair-foldable-3-wheel-exercise-stroller-midnight-black-1037.jpgPrams are suitable for newborns or infants up to 6 months old. They usually come with a bassinet or carrycot, and lie flat. Some prams can be converted to fit carseats, which is why they are referred to as travel systems.

Parasol

A parasol is an umbrella that clips onto the frame of your pushchair to shade your baby and prevent heat stroke. They are usually made of SPF/UPF 50+ fabrics and can also offer protection against light rain. Many pushchairs have a built-in sun canopy or a removable pram parasol, but if yours doesn't have one you can buy an additional one. You can also opt for a snooze shade, which attaches to the seat of your single pram or carrycot and blocks the overhead light.

Parent facing

Parents appreciate the ability to maintain eye contact with their child while they are in prams that are oriented towards parents. This visual connection aids in building trust and security and can soothe toddlers and infants who are agitated. This enables parents to respond to the needs of their child quickly, whether it is reassurance or an ice cream.

While many parents prefer to use a pram to transport newborns and infants, they might change to a pushchair when their children grow older. A pram is different from a pushchair because it usually includes a carry-cot for newborns and a frame on which to fix it. A pram can recline and be made forward-facing or facing the parent. A pushchair, on the other hand is typically upright and has no carry cot.

When selecting a pushchair, ensure that it's easy to use and that the brakes function properly. It is also important to make sure that the chassis is secured with two locking mechanisms to stop it from folding when in use. A safety harness is vital to ensure your child's safety in the seat and to prevent them from falling out. To prevent mildew and mould prams and strollers need to be cleaned regularly. Most components can be cleaned by vacuuming them or wiping them clean with warm soapy water and an absorbent towel. If you're worried about the fabric, a specialised cleaning spray can help.

Check the tyres of a pushchair if you are using it on rough terrain. The most durable tyres are a mixture of PU outer and EVA inside that are similar to air-tyres in feel but are much more durable.
